GoodSync
Backup & Sync
GoodSync is a file synchronization and backup software that allows users to synchronize files between folders, disks, remote servers, and cloud storage. It supports two-way sync, can detect moved or renamed files, has a history of file versions, and supports AES 256-bit encryption.

SWAD
Education & Reference
SWAD (Shared Workspace At a Distance) is a free and open source web application aimed at universities and schools for supporting collaborative learning online. It allows instructors to create virtual classrooms with forums, documents, assignments, polls and more.
